Output 81463642520ee87d144a54256e24ebb0f0f2d3a105de73edf1bf9943598987b9:7

value
27334102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70b3b1b01abeadf821450431b8f6ac681f8f0dcf OP_EQUAL
address
MJB5BHB7wU9e8KBYhWaJHTHkw2apJTLcn2
transaction
81463642520ee87d144a54256e24ebb0f0f2d3a105de73edf1bf9943598987b9
spent
true